To date, only a handful of these Italian made gems exist and only one has attained the elite grade of Near Mint + by the most critical grader in the business, Beckett (BGS/BVG). This card is simply unbelievable when you consider that it is over 40 Years old. The subgrades are Centering 9.5, Corners 9, Edges 9.5, and Surface 8. Do the math, this beauty could be a 9 at other grading houses not so harsh on surface. It's already the highest grade ever for this card. It's hard to imagine a card with more explosive potential than this rookie card of the most famous athlete of all-time. Ali stands ahead of even the most popular of athletes. Other cards attempt to lay claim to being Ali/Clay's rookie card but they are either made of thin magazine paper or grossly oversized. This is Clay's rookie and a real trading card with size and stock that resembles a regular card. This card also precedes Ali/Clay's popular 1966 Italian "rookie" which is often sold for thousands of dollars and was made years later.
